https://mathweb.ru/allsystem.html?id=303554

Умножить 1058,6875(10) на 1011010110,0101001(2) = 768946.23583984375000 Столбиком

Введите два числа и укажите их основание системы счиления:

Вы ввели числа в различных системах счисления. Однако в расчете могут участвовать числа только в одинаковых системах счисления. Мы переведём второе число 1011010110.01010012 в 10-ричную систему счисления вот так:

Выполним перевод в десятичную систему счисления вот так:

1∙29+0∙28+1∙27+1∙26+0∙25+1∙24+0∙23+1∙22+1∙21+0∙20+0∙2-1+1∙2-2+0∙2-3+1∙2-4+0∙2-5+0∙2-6+1∙2-7 = 1∙512+0∙256+1∙128+1∙64+0∙32+1∙16+0∙8+1∙4+1∙2+0∙1+0∙0.5+1∙0.25+0∙0.125+1∙0.0625+0∙0.03125+0∙0.015625+1∙0.0078125 = 512+0+128+64+0+16+0+4+2+0+0+0.25+0+0.0625+0+0+0.0078125 = 726.320312510

Получилось: 1011010110.01010012 =726.320312510

x1058.6875000
726.3203125
+52934375000
21173750000
10586875000
31760625000
00000000000
21173750000
31760625000
63521250000
21173750000
74108125000
768946.23583984375000
Ответ: 1058.687510 * 1011010110.01010012 = 768946.2358398437500010